McDuffie, Chairperson of the Committee on Business and Economic Development will hold a public hearing to consider the following bills: B23-0404, the "Deputy Mayor for Planning and Economic Development Limited Grant Making Authority for Check IT Enterprises Amendment Act of 2019," B23-0438, the "Small and Local Business Assistance Amendment Act of 2019," B23-0439, the "Longtime Resident Business Preservation Amendment Act of 2019," and B23-0432, the "Protecting Local Area Commercial Enterprises Amendment Act of 2019." The stated purpose of B23-0404 is to amend the Deputy Mayor for Planning and Economic Development Limited Grant-Making Authority Act of 2012 to provide the department authority to issue a grant to Check IT Enterprises, to enable acquisition of a facility in historic Anacostia, which will serve as an educational and resource center for at-risk youth. The stated purpose of B23-0438 is to provide qualified small and local businesses with a tax credit for a portion of rent or property taxes paid and to reduce the taxable value of commercial property if it is rented or owned by a qualifying small and local business. The stated purpose of B23-0439, the "Longtime Resident Business Preservation Amendment Act of 2019," is to create a Longtime Resident Business Preservation Program to provide grants and low-interest loans for longtime resident businesses at risk of displacement. Lastly, the stated purpose of B23-0432 is to establish the Legacy Business Program within the Department of Small and Local Business Development in order to provide longtime District-based businesses with technical and financial assistance and to provide property owners with financial incentives to enter into or renew affordable leases with legacy business owners.
